The Washington Commanders will be without their top cornerback Sunday against the Philadelphia Eagles. William Jackson III is inactive with a back injury.

The Commanders added Jackson to the game status report on Saturday. Washington will need to reshuffle their secondary. Expect seventh-round draft pick Christian Holmes to get an increase workload to slot next to Kendall Fuller and Benjamin St-Juste.

Jackson won’t be Washington’s only defensive starter out Sunday. Defensive end James Smith-Williams is inactive with an abdomen injury. The Commanders are already down Chase Young on the edge. Now his replacement is out.

Making things worse for the Commanders, fellow defensive end Casey Toohill is out with a concussion. Toohill would have been the option to slot in place of Smith-Williams. William Bradley-King was elevated for the game.

Shaka Toney and Efe Obada should split time playing opposite of Montez Sweat on the edge.

The good news for the Commanders is safety Kamren Curl will make his season debut. The star safety missed the first two games of the season with a thumb injury that required surgery. Curl could line up in the Buffalo Nickel which may help the cornerback rotation.

Rookie quarterback Sam Howell, guard Chris Paul and tight end Cole Turner are also inactive along with defensive tackle Daniel Wise.
